Abstract

An optical interconnect transfers data between a plurality of processors. An input-ring array receivers a plurality of data modulated light beams. Each data modulated light beam has a plurality of light wavelengths and is associated with one of the processors. An output-ring array outputs a light beam to each processor. A plurality of prisms and optical element reflectors transfer light from the input-ring array to the output-ring array and uniquely rotates each wavelength of the transferred light.
